These heat activated solder shrink connectors work well, making secure butt connections. Please note that the proper amount of heat must be applied to activate/melt the solder. A heat gun is essential to properly use these connectors. Please also be aware hair dryer should not be used as a heating device, as it will not provide sufficient heat to melt the encapsulated solder. Once cooled, the connection is permanent and quite strong. I highly recommend these connectors.

These are incredible. I have used these now for multiple applications, from a car to sprinkler wires to vending machines. Just carry a heat gun and short extension cord for most places and you're set. You do strip the wires farther than you usually would with a crimp. The only thing I will say somewhat as a warning is that they work way better with stranded wire than solid wire. I have had a couple instances where solid wire pokes a hole in the coupler and I have to start over. Other than that, these are easy to use, guarantee a solid connection, go waterproof, and make it so that the connection isn't a massive piece of plastic that you will be able to see even under shrinkwrap. If you cover the wire with shrinkwrap afterwards, you won't even notice that there is a splice in the wire

These things are so cool. Best consistent butt connection I've ever been able to make. I use a heat gun with the narrow tip. You can burn through them if you're not careful. There is a fine line between hot enough to melt the solder ring and not melt the heat shrink. Once you get the hang of it you can do it every time. I lost his the little colored ring grips the wire too. You can kinda hit that part first to help hold the wire then hold it on the solder ring. I always do another layer of heat shrink just in case I burn through the one it's made of. I will definitely buy more of these. I hope they have different types of connectors in this same style. I used the cordless DeWalt heat gun on high....say about 2" away from the splices. Forgot to use a reflector. Didn't burn or brown.....does take a good 30+ seconds to get the solder to melt. Mainly focus on the solder, and not the shrink tubing. The blue ones worked fine. When I was using one to one wire. But when I had to do 2 to 1 and used the large yellow...each one split....on the doubled up side. So I don't think they can handle uneven splices. Additionally. . when they split, the soldier is not "pushed" into the wore, so the soldier just pools up on the outside and doesn't bond. I didn't dock a star for this, as they work well....just not in this way (2 to 1 splice.....which the instructions don't even mention)
